The Greater Jacksonville Kingfish Tournament is an annual July event held at Jim King Park & Boat Ramp on the Intracoastal Waterway in Jacksonville. It’s centered on competitive kingfish angling and draws both serious fishing participants and spectators who enjoy the lively waterfront atmosphere.1 If you’ll be in town July 15–18, it’s a very local way to experience Jacksonville’s boating and fishing culture.
